Types of Best Pull Up Grips Explained
The market offers diverse types of best pull up grips, each serving a unique functional purpose.
Different categories/types available:
- Lifting Straps (Harbinger, COFOF): Traditional loops of material (cotton, nylon, or leather) wrapped around the bar and the wrist. They maximize the mechanical connection to the bar, allowing the user to lift heavier weights than their raw grip allows.
- Lifting Hooks (DMoose, RELIFE): These feature a rigid steel hook secured around the wrist by a thick strap. They are the fastest method to completely eliminate grip strength as a limiting factor in pulling movements.
- Minimalist Pads (NiuMid, PULLUP & DIP): Fingerless, small pads made of rubber or neoprene that protect the palm from friction, blisters, and calluses without the bulk of a full glove.
- Gymnastic/Calisthenics Grips (JerkFit): Often leather or carbon fiber, designed specifically to cover the palm and create a barrier (or “dowel”) over the bar, crucial for continuous, high-speed rotations in functional fitness (T2B, muscle-ups).
- Ergonomic Handles (Fitarc, Neutral Grip Handles): Specialized attachments that convert a straight bar into a comfortable neutral grip, often used for joint pain mitigation or specific muscle targeting.
Which type suits different fitness goals:
- Powerlifting/Bodybuilding: Lifting Straps (COFOF, Harbinger) or Hooks (DMoose) are essential for maximizing progressive overload during deadlifts, shrugs, and heavy rows.
- Calisthenics/Cross Training: Gymnastic Grips (JerkFit) or Minimalist Pads (NiuMid) are best for protecting the hands during dynamic, high-volume movements like kipping pull-ups.
- Joint Recovery/Isolation: Ergonomic Handles (Fitarc) are necessary to shift the angle of pull away from compromised joints (wrists, elbows).

Common Questions About Best Pull Up Grips
Do I Need Separate Grips For Pull-Ups And Deadlifts?
Yes, typically. Pull-up grips (like gymnastic leather) are designed to prevent skin rips and friction during high volume. Deadlift straps or hooks are designed to completely secure the hand to the bar, bypassing forearm fatigue to lift maximum weight. While some straps (Harbinger) can perform both functions, specialized grips excel in their specific domain.
Are Pull Up Hooks Considered Cheating In Weightlifting?
In competitive powerlifting (deadlifts), hooks are illegal. However, for general training, bodybuilding, or hypertrophy goals, hooks are excellent tools (like DMoose or RELIFE) because they allow you to isolate the larger back muscles (lats, traps) by removing the limiting factor of grip strength.
How Should I Maintain Leather Gymnastic Grips To Ensure Longevity?
Leather grips (like JerkFit) should never be stored damp. After use, allow them to air dry completely. Avoid using detergents, but mild saddle soap can be used occasionally. Keeping them pliable and clean will prevent the leather from hardening and cracking.
What Is The Difference Between A 2-Finger And A 3-Finger Grip?
A 2-finger grip (JerkFit) leaves the index finger free, which provides more dexterity and comfort for athletes with shorter palms or those who prioritize wrist mobility. A 3-finger grip offers greater coverage but can feel restrictive between the fingers.
Will Using The Best Pull Up Grips Weaken My Natural Grip Strength?
If you rely on straps or hooks for all pulling movements, your natural grip strength may plateau. The professional recommendation is to use grips only on your heaviest sets (85% 1RM or higher) or during high-rep volume work once genuine grip fatigue sets in. Always include dedicated forearm work without assistance to maintain functional grip power.
How Does Neoprene Compare To Rubber For Anti-Slip Performance?
Neoprene (PULLUP & DIP) is generally softer and more cushioning, but it tends to compress under heavy load and can become slicker when saturated with sweat. Rubber (NiuMid) is denser, provides higher innate friction, and maintains its form better, offering superior anti-slip performance, especially on steel bars.
